Glenda makes an online purchase of 4 picture frames for $12.95 each and 4 mats for $5.89 each. The site says that taxes paid by the customer are 6.5% of the total purchase price. Shipping charges are based on the following table:
Amount of Purchase
Standard Shipping
Express Shipping
up to $50
$5.10
$7.00
$50 up to $100
$6.35
$8.20
$100 up to $200
$7.80
$11.60
$200 and over
$10.50
$16.45
Glenda selects express shipping for her purchase and the company bills her credit card $91.86 for the total of the online purchase. Determine if Glenda has been billed correctly for her purchase.
a.
Glenda has been billed correctly.
b.
Glenda has not been charged enough for her purchase.
c.
Glenda has been over charged by $3.40 for her purchase.
d.
Glenda has been over charged by $3.80 for her purchase.

To determine if Glenda has been billed correctly, we need to calculate the total cost of her purchase, including the cost of the picture frames, mats, taxes, and express shipping charges.
1. **Calculate the total cost of picture frames:**
- Price per frame = $12.95
- Number of frames = 4
- Total cost of frames = 4 × $12.95 = $51.80
2. **Calculate the total cost of mats:**
- Price per mat = $5.89
- Number of mats = 4
- Total cost of mats = 4 × $5.89 = $23.56
3. **Calculate the subtotal of the purchase:**
- Subtotal = Total cost of frames + Total cost of mats
- Subtotal = $51.80 + $23.56 = $75.36
4. **Calculate the tax:**
- Tax rate = 6.5%
- Tax amount = 0.065 × $75.36 = $4.90 (approximately)
5. **Calculate the total cost before shipping:**
- Total before shipping = Subtotal + Tax
- Total before shipping = $75.36 + $4.90 = $80.26
6. **Determine the shipping charge for express shipping:**
- Since the subtotal ($75.36) is between $50 and $100, the express shipping charge is $8.20.
7. **Calculate the final total:**
- Total cost = Total before shipping + Shipping charge
- Total cost = $80.26 + $8.20 = $88.46
Glenda has been billed $91.86, but the calculated total is $88.46.
8. **Determine if Glenda has been overcharged:**
- Overcharge amount = Billed amount - Calculated total
- Overcharge amount = $91.86 - $88.46 = $3.40
Since the calculated total is $88.46 and Glenda was billed $91.86, she has indeed been overcharged by $3.40.
The best answer to this question is:
**C - Glenda has been overcharged by $3.40 for her purchase.**
